Re:Please TEACH me ghettodyne + ecucontrol
There are a couple of free ROM editors in the works for OBD1, but nothing just yet. If you want to make custom programs immediately you'll have to use Excel ------sheets and a hex editor like the rest of us. It looks like a couple weeks is all that's needed to have some pretty good free OBD1 program editors out.
The stock ROMs with datalogging enabled are already available if you want to go ahead and get comfortable with burning chips and datalogging. |

Re:Please TEACH me ghettodyne + ecucontrol
Smokey, you got it. The Batronix software is just a burner app, like Nero/CDRWin/Fireburner/Roxio/etc used for burning CDs.
I guess if they have me pimping in this place, I should do a write-up on Ghettodyne and Batronix's Prog-Studio, complete with screenshots. It really is pretty simple, it's a lot harder to desolder the chip in your ECU. atomik, most of the OBD1 Civic/Integra stuff can be tweaked - they use three different motherboard platforms (four if you count the wierd 1560 VX board) all of which can be upgraded on the hardware level to and from manual, auto, VTEC, knock, etc. Only IABs are supported by the P72/75. Most of the code can be tweaked for VTEC, revlimit, fuel/spark, but up until recently you did it all in a hex editor... Uberego (RIP) came up with a nifty program to do the editing for you, and released the naturally aspirated version to the general public. |
